description | To provide an abrasive wheel capable of preventing a grindstone from coming off an abrasive wheel during grinding processing or being broken without coming off.SOLUTION: An abrasive wheel includes: an annular base that has a free end surface and a surface for being mounted on a wheel mount; an annular groove that is annularly formed on the free end surface of the annular base; and a plurality of grindstones that are fixed to the annular groove with an adhesive infilled into the annular groove. The annular groove is defined by a pair of side walls and a top surface. The side wall assumes a shape that spreads out like an unfolded fan toward the top surface from the free end surface.SELECTED DRAWING: Figure 3
